NJTank Posted April 1, 2007 Share Posted April 1, 2007 What team signed the legendary Sid Finch Link to comment Share on other sites More sharing options...
FloPoErich Posted April 1, 2007 Share Posted April 1, 2007 Was it the Mets Link to comment Share on other sites More sharing options...
NJTank Posted April 1, 2007 Author Share Posted April 1, 2007 Correct Link to comment Share on other sites More sharing options...
infrared41 Posted April 1, 2007 Share Posted April 1, 2007 Technically, Sid wasn't signed by anyone since he didn't actually exist. Link to comment Share on other sites More sharing options...
Recommended Posts
Archived
This topic is now archived and is closed to further replies.